The Legal Reality for Utah Consumers

In Utah, defense attorneys can challenge Merchant Cash Advances by scrutinizing whether the funder honored mandatory reconciliation clauses when business revenues declined. If a funder ignores these contractual obligations, the transaction may be recharacterized as a disguised, usurious loan rather than a purchase of future receivables. Furthermore, if Cedar Advance has already obtained a judgment by confession or default, we can move to file a Motion to Vacate under Utah Rule of Civil Procedure 60(b). We focus on identifying instances where due process was compromised or where confessions were obtained under false pretenses to challenge the validity of the judgment.

Ignoring a court summons or failing to respond to a judgment in Utah can lead to severe consequences, including bank levies and the seizure of business assets.
